About this Item

A Japanese Satsuma two-handled vase, by Kinkozan zo, Meiji period, 1868-1912
baluster, the front and back enamelled with a festival, the banners with script, the reverse with entertainers before the entrance to a temple with cherry blossoms in the distance, the gilded neck moulded with shaped handles incorporating a petal-shaped panel to either side enclosing a pheasant amongst wisteria and two further birds amongst blossoms, enclosed by a gilt Greek-key border, raised on a low foot, iron-red and gilt Kinkozan zo seal mark, impressed Kinkozan zo mark, minor hairline cracks, 22,7cm high

Provenance

Property of an Oriental Collector.
